a wooden pillar in the shape of a square prism has a base side length, s, of 4 inches and a height, h, of 9 inches. find the surface area of the pillar. use the formula sa = 2s² + 4sh. a. 176 square inches b. 208 square inches c. 1,296 square inches d. 2,448 square inches
Step1: Substitute the values into the formula
Given \(s = 4\) inches and \(h=9\) inches, and the formula \(SA = 2s^{2}+4sh\).
First, calculate \(2s^{2}\):
\(2s^{2}=2\times4^{2}=2\times16 = 32\)
Second, calculate \(4sh\):
\(4sh=4\times4\times9=144\)
Step2: Calculate the surface area
Then, find \(SA\) by adding the two results:
\(SA=2s^{2}+4sh=32 + 144\)
